Description / Abstract: Introduction

Note: Nothing in this standard supercedes applicable laws and regulations.

Note: In the event of conflict between the English and domestic language, the English language shall take precedence.

Purpose. The purpose of the relay is to switch and carry load currents while a minor control current through the relay coil is applied.

The relay shall provide only two (2) operating modes:
  • Switching Contact Open: No current flows
  • Switching Contact Closed: Load current flows An intermediate stage is not permitted.


Applicability. This standard applies to the following relays which are defined as follows:
  • Relay with Normally Closed (NC) contacts: Single Pole Single Throw (SPST), NC
  • Relay with Normally Open (NO) contacts: SPST, NO
  • Relay with changeover contacts: Single Pole Double Throw (SPDT)
  • Relay with multiple contacts: Double Pole Double Throw (DPDT)
  • Solid State Relay (SSR): Constructed with electronic components which switch the load current on and off by means of Field Effect Transistors (FET) or electromechanical relays
  • Multiple coil
  • Latching


Remarks. This specification covers the testing of general purpose electromechanical plug-in, Printed Circuit Board (PCB), and SSRs. It presents a series of physical, environmental and durability tests, and product requirements which are used to determine the capability of a relay as specified by the part drawing.

Where a user's engineering practices or needs are not applicable to all features of this standard, it is intended that as many details as is practical be followed.
